Duties:


Working in the Management Section and reporting to post's Management Officer, with guidance from the Global Community Liaison Office (GTM/GCLO), the CLO Coordinator develops, implements, and manages a program based on community demographics and post-specific needs.

The CLO Coordinator executes morale enhancing activities under eight Areas of Responsibility (family member employment; crisis management and security; education; communications and outreach; guidance and referral; welcoming, orientation, and departures; community liaison; and events planning).

Identifies needs and responds with effective programming, information and resources, and referrals. CLO is an ICASS mandatory package service provider, and as such serves all participating USG agencies at post.

The CLO is a rated ICASS service provider whose base constituency includes all direct-hire employees and family members under Chief of Mission authority.

HIRING PREFERENCE ORDER:

  • AEFM / USEFM who is a preference-eligible U.S. Veteran*AEFM / USEFM
  • FS on LWOP and CS with reemployment rights**-IMPORTANT: Applicants who claim status as a preference-eligible U.S. Veteran must submit a copy of their most recent DD-214 ("Certificate of Release or Discharge from Active Duty"), Letter from Veterans' Affairs which indicates the present existence of a service-connected disability dated within the past six months, equivalent documentation, or certification. A "certification" is any written document from the armed forces that certifies the service member is expected to be discharged or released from active duty service in the armed forces under honorable conditions within 120 days after the certification is submitted by the applicant. The certification letter should be on letterhead of the appropriate military branch of the service and contain (1) the military service dates including the expected discharge or release date; and (2) the character of service. Acceptable documentation must be submitted in order for the preference to be given.
**This level of preference applies to all Foreign Service employees on LWOP and CS with re-employment rights back to their agency or bureau.
